广州红匣子新闻中心

关注互联网,关注技术开发,透析与分享移动互联网行业最新动态

主页 > 新闻中心 > APP开发 > 小程序开发的详细流程

陈经理

15年全栈工程师

广州红匣子技术负责人

15年APP开发经验、精通JAVA框架

360

开发案例

795

已咨询人数

小程序开发的详细流程

时间:2025-03-28 17:03:00来源:红匣子科技阅读:250328
小程序开发的详细流程微信小程序是一种轻量级的应用程序,用户可以在微信内直接使用,无需下载安装。开发小程序的流程相对简单,以下是详细的步骤:1. 注册小程序账号首先,开发者需要访问微信公众平台(mp.weixin.qq.com),选择“小程序”进行注册。填写相关信息后,激活邮箱并完成基本信息的填写。注

小程序开发的详细流程

微信小程序是一种轻量级的应用程序,用户可以在微信内直接使用,无需下载安装。开发小程序的流程相对简单,以下是详细的步骤:

1. 注册小程序账号

首先,开发者需要访问微信公众平台(mp.weixin.qq.com),选择“小程序”进行注册。填写相关信息后,激活邮箱并完成基本信息的填写。注册完成后,系统会分配一个唯一的AppID,这是后续开发中必不可少的标识。

2. 准备开发环境

在注册完成后,开发者需要下载并安装微信开发者工具。该工具支持Windows和MacOS系统,安装后需使用微信扫描二维码进行登录。登录后,选择“新建小程序项目”,输入AppID、项目名称和目录等基本信息。

3. 创建小程序项目

在微信开发者工具中,开发者可以选择空白模板或示例模板来快速上手。项目的基本结构包括四个主要文件:

  • .js:业务逻辑
  • .json:配置文件
  • .wxml:页面结构
  • .wxss:样式表

开发者可以根据需求编写相应的代码,构建小程序的功能和界面。

4. 编写小程序代码

在项目中,开发者需要实现小程序的业务逻辑和用户交互。可以使用JavaScript编写逻辑代码,使用WXML定义页面结构,使用WXSS进行样式设计。开发者可以通过调试工具实时预览效果,确保功能正常。

5. 测试小程序

在完成代码编写后,开发者需要对小程序进行全面测试。可以通过微信开发者工具的“预览”功能,查看小程序在不同设备上的表现,确保用户体验良好。

6. 提交审核

测试完成后,开发者需要在微信公众平台提交小程序进行审核。审核通过后,小程序将正式上线,用户可以在微信中搜索并使用。

7. 上线与维护

小程序上线后,开发者需要定期维护和更新,确保其功能和内容的及时性。同时,可以根据用户反馈进行优化,提升用户体验。

小程序开发的深度扩展

小程序的开发不仅仅是技术实现,还涉及到市场需求、用户体验和运营策略等多个方面。以下是一些相关的延伸写作内容:

市场需求分析

在开始开发小程序之前,开发者需要进行市场调研,了解目标用户的需求和偏好。这可以通过问卷调查、用户访谈等方式进行。了解用户的痛点和需求,有助于在功能设计和界面布局上做出更合理的决策。

用户体验设计

用户体验(UX)是小程序成功的关键因素之一。开发者需要关注界面的简洁性、操作的便捷性以及信息的清晰度。可以通过原型设计工具(如Axure、Sketch等)进行界面设计,确保用户在使用过程中能够快速上手,减少学习成本。

功能模块的选择

根据市场需求和用户反馈,开发者可以选择合适的功能模块进行开发。例如,电商类小程序可以加入购物车、支付、订单管理等功能;而服务类小程序则可以加入预约、咨询等功能。合理的功能模块选择能够提升小程序的实用性和用户粘性。

推广与运营策略

小程序上线后,如何吸引用户使用是一个重要问题。开发者可以通过社交媒体、微信朋友圈、公众号等渠道进行推广。同时,结合线下活动、优惠券等营销手段,提升用户的使用率和活跃度。

数据分析与优化

上线后,开发者需要定期对小程序的数据进行分析,了解用户的使用习惯和行为。通过数据分析,可以发现问题并进行针对性的优化。例如,若发现某个功能的使用率较低,可以考虑重新设计或增加引导提示。

法律合规与安全性

在开发小程序时,开发者还需关注法律合规问题,确保小程序的内容和功能符合相关法律法规。同时,数据安全也是一个重要方面,开发者需要采取措施保护用户的隐私和数据安全,避免信息泄露。

通过以上步骤和延伸内容,开发者可以更全面地理解小程序开发的流程和注意事项,从而提高小程序的成功率和用户满意度。

本站所有文章资源收集整理于网络,本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如不慎侵犯了您的权利,请及时联系站长处理删除,敬请谅解!
广州APP定制开发公司

上一篇:小程序开发的步骤

下一篇:小程序开发的费用

最新新闻

相关推荐

立即联系 售前产品经理

电话沟通

微信咨询